GENERALIZED LOCAL COHOMOLOGY AND THE INTERSECTION THEOREM

ABSTRACT

Let R be a commutative Noetherian ring and let 𝔞 be an ideal of R. For complexes X and Y of R-modules we investigate the invariant inf RΓ𝔞(RHom R (X, Y)) in certain cases. It is shown that, for bounded complexes X and Y with finite homology, dim Y ≤ dim RHom R (X, Y) ≤ proj.dim X + dim(X  Y) + sup X, which strengthen the intersection theorem. Here inf X and sup X denote the homological infimum and supremum of the complex X, respectively.
